Distance From Portland International Airport to Balt./Wash. International Airport (PDX - BWI Distance)
The flight distance from Portland International Airport (PDX) to Balt./Wash. International Airport (BWI) is 2353 miles. This is equivalent to 3786 kilometers or 2043 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.
3786 kilometers is the distance from Portland International Airport, United States to Balt./Wash. International Airport, United States.
Flight Duration between Portland, United States and Baltimore, United States
Estimated flight time from Portland International Airport, Portland, United States to Balt./Wash. International Airport, Baltimore, United States is 4 hours 42 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
